Adored this hotel and would stay again, even with its shortcomings (listed below)! Things we LOVED - LOCATION! - shutters over the balcony doors blocked sound/light. The room was exceptionally quiet considering how busy the neighborhood is. - the layout of the room was super funky/fun, and balcony over the street was fantastic - the mattress was firm and comfortable- no “dip” - lounge area outside our room was fantastic! Loved having easy access to cold water (still or sparkling!) to refill our bottles, a very well stocked coffee and tea station, and yummy little cookies (biscuits) and gummies. - the woman filling the coffee station was wonderful and so helpful! - welcome wine and snacks!! Things to improve: - There were a few spots where the room was very well worn. The kick plate under the toilet room was rotten and falling apart and the shower stall showed lots of wear. - The desk staff were not knowledgeable about the area. We asked for suggestions for food within a 30 minute walk (a large area) and they gave us a typed list (great!) but said they’d never tried any of them nor did they have any suggestions of their own, or ever hear any feedback from other locals. A bummer but we also recognize not everyone is able to eat out…so this is definitely a first world problem. - Although the room had a good A/C, we wish the duvet was thinner/lighter OR the bed had a top sheet (something we found rarely in our travels). Even with the A/C cranking…we were melting once in bed.
